Dell and Cloudera to enable data analysis through open source solution

 

Enterprises looking to process massive application
datasets can now utilize the industry’s first complete Apache Hadoop solution,
resulting from a relationship between Dell and Cloudera Inc. The Dell |
Cloudera solution for Apache Hadoop combines Dell servers and networking
components with Cloudera’s Distribution Including Apache Hadoop (CDH).

 

As well as management tools, training, technology support
and professional services, to give customers a single source to deploy, manage,
and scale a comprehensive Apache Hadoop-based stack.

 

Aimed at financial services, energy, utility and telecom
companies, research institutions, retail businesses, and Internet/media groups,
The Dell | Cloudera solution for Apache Hadoop can reduce the complexity of
deploying, configuring, and managing Hadoop systems.

 

By combining the leading open source Apache Hadoop-based
software platform and purpose-built hardware, the integrated Dell | Cloudera
solution for Hadoop enables organizations to analyze large amounts of complex,
dynamic data at a lower total cost of ownership (TCO) than proprietary
solutions.

The Dell | Cloudera solution for Apache Hadoop consists
of CDH, Dell Crowbar software, and Cloudera Enterprise
combined with a Dell PowerEdge C2100 server (other models to be added shortly)
and PowerConnect 6248 48-port Gigabit Ethernet Layer 3 switch.Joint service and
support and a deployment guide are also included.

 

This solution also leverages Dell’s popular Crowbar
software, which Dell has released to the community as open source.

 

Crowbar manages the Apache Hadoop deployment from the
initial server boot to the configuration of the primary Apache Hadoop
components allowing users to complete bare metal deployment of multi-node
Hadoop environments in a matter of hours, as opposed to days.

 

Once the initial deployment is complete, Crowbar can be
used to maintain, expand, and architect a complete data analytics solution,
including BIOS configuration, network discovery, status monitoring, performance
data gathering, and alerting. Crowbar provides the necessary tools and
automation to manage the complete lifecycle of Hadoop environments.
